Veteran actress Zeenat Aman is once again winning hearts on social media with yet another gem from her treasure trove of memories. Known as the “anecdote queen” by fans and followers, Zeenat took to Instagram and revisited a breezy, sun-soaked memory from the 1983 film Pukar, offering fans a delightful behind-the-scenes peek into the shooting of the popular song Samundar Mein Naha Ke.

In her candid and charming post, the actress set the tone with a relatable summer remark: “It’s just so damn hot!”, before leading fans into the story behind the iconic beach song featuring none other than Amitabh Bachchan. She recalled how the song was filmed on a serene, almost deserted beach in Goa, describing the coastal town of the early 80s as “quiet, idyllic and unpeopled.”

With her signature wit, Zeenat humorously confessed that her role in the sequence was simple, to look pretty! Dressed in a striking white outfit, with a hint of glam, she playfully rolled in the waves while Amitabh Bachchan danced around her with what she fondly called “bird-of-paradise energy.”

However, not everything was as effortless as it seemed. Zeenat revealed that she doesn’t know how to swim, and shooting in the ocean tested her nerves. From swallowing seawater to getting sand in all the wrong places, the experience was far from glamorous. Yet, with her usual grace, she managed to pull off the role of a stunning “jal pari” (mermaid) convincingly.

Adding to the emotional depth of her post, Zeenat reminded fans that this was Amitabh Bachchan’s first shoot after recovering from his near-fatal accident on the sets of Coolie. The country had collectively prayed for his recovery, and the atmosphere on set during Pukar was filled with hope and joy.
